The Clinical Education System Analyst is a system-service role which owns outcomes planning, strategy, metric definition assistance, data mining, data analysis, and reporting for all Clinical Education within St. Charles Health System. This role serves as an administrator for: learning systems, Lippincott, Workday Learning, Kahuna, EEDS, PARS and others as needed. The educational outcomes reports generated by this position are a key component for maintaining Accreditation with the ACCME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education, and the Joint Commission. This position is also responsible for reporting Community Benefit on behalf of the medical education department for medical education and healthcare awareness activities that occur within our region. This position does not directly manage any other caregivers but may train and/or serve as a mentor to new members of the Continuing Medical Education team.

Essential Functions And Duties

Participates in Quality & Safety meetings, partners with other departments across the system, follows the release of new national guidelines, and tracks medical and science news to identify and address professional practice gaps.

Identifies, analyzes, and interprets trends and patterns in data sets to help determine educational priorities and initiatives and to measure effectiveness.

Collects, tracks, submits, and analyzes data reporting for Community Benefit on behalf of the medical education department. Develops an implementation strategy, based on identified significant health needs; measures the impact of community benefit programs.

Develops and validates an educational outcomes measurement design and reporting system that captures and effectively communicates change stemming from educational interventions.

Identifies and translates relevant information from a variety of sources into concise, well-organized reports and presentations for distribution to shareholders on a quarterly basis.

Serves as, and maintains the technical skills and knowledge required by, an Epic Super User and EEDS Super user.

Researches opportunities for Independent Medical Education (IME) grant offerings, writes and submits online grant applications targeted to specific request for proposals (RFPs), and follows a grant application throughout its life cycle.

Serves as EEDS (Electronic Education Documentation System) and PARS (Program and Activity Reporting System) system administrator, including managing monthly XML activity uploads, MOC credit reporting, error reports and providing light IT assistance to learners.

Provides Audio Visual assistance for educational activities.

Performs quarterly QAs on all department Teams files under the rules of accrediting bodies.

Edits and posts video recordings from training.

Supports the planning and implementation of UME, GME, CME and AHEC activities on an as-needed basis.

EDUCATION

Required: Bachelor’s degree in life science, math, physics, statistics, economics, or a related field. Equivalent prior experience enabling performance of the position may be considered in lieu of degree.

Preferred: Master’s Degree in a related field.

LICENSURE/CERTIFICATION/REGISTRATION

Required: N/A

Preferred: Earned professional certificate related to nursing education, continuing medical education (CME), or other educational specialty.

Experience

Required: Three years’ minimum experience in the medical education or healthcare field. Familiarity with adult learning theory and models for measuring CME outcomes.

Preferred: Experience with ACCME PARS system and Maintenance of Certification (Moc) reporting to specialty boards
